  <dc:title>Correspondence - 'Incidental letters'</dc:title>
  <dc:description>File labelled  'incidental letters from editor, writers, readers and the BBC (with contracts) during 1989...1994 - Exeter University and solicitor'. Also includes first lists of items sent to Wheal Martyn Museum. Most of the letters discuss Clemo's work, but also religion and the fate of his cottage at Goonvean and other issues. Correspondents include Derek Savage, Christian Living for a Change magazine, Tracy Chevalier at St James Press, William Oxley.</dc:description>
  <dc:date>1988-1994</dc:date>
